BACKGROUND: The ambulatory arterial stiffness ındex (AASI), derived from ambulatory blood pressure monitoring, functions as a straightforward surrogate marker for arterial stiffness. Vascular age, calculated utilizing the SCORE Project, has gained increasing prominence and accessibility as a tool for conveying cardiovascular (CV) risk and is progressively recognized as a surrogate marker for vascular biological aging. AIMS: Our aim was to assess the association between the AASI and SCORE-derived vascular age in individuals without established CV disease. METHODS: In this cross-sectional study, 276 patients (53.6% women) aged 40-65 years without CV, cerebrovascular disease, or diabetes mellitus were evaluated. AASI was calculated from 24-hour ambulatory blood pressure monitoring data, and vascular age was estimated using SCORE charts. The strength and independence of the association between the AASI and vascular age were evaluated using Pearson's correlation and multivariable linear regression analyses. RESULTS: The mean vascular age was 59.7 years and mean AASI was 0.39. AASI was significantly associated with vascular age (r = 0.529; P <0.001). In the multivariable analysis, a 0.1-unit increase in AASI corresponded to a 0.992-year increase in vascular age (P = 0.015), independent of age, metabolic syndrome, and left ventricular mass. CONCLUSIONS: AASI is significantly associated with SCORE-derived vascular age, highlighting its potential utility as a simple, non-invasive indicator of vascular biological aging and a valuable tool for early CV risk stratification in outpatient settings.
